Bid leveling software can help a general contractor move faster, but it cannot decide scope responsibility by itself. The software can organize proposals, normalize alternates, highlight exclusions, keep a bid log, and make handoff cleaner. The contractor still has to know what a complete scope looks like.

That distinction matters. A tool that makes a bad scope comparison look polished can create more confidence than the estimate deserves. A useful tool should make gaps easier to find, not hide them behind a clean dashboard.

This guide is written for builders, remodelers, and light commercial GCs comparing bid leveling tools, plan rooms, buyout platforms, and preconstruction software. It is not a vendor ranking. Vendor claims should be verified through demos, references, trial projects, contract terms, and your own workflow.

What Bid Leveling Software Should Actually Do

Bid leveling is the process of comparing subcontractor proposals against the same scope, assumptions, alternates, inclusions, exclusions, schedule, and contract requirements. It is not just sorting low to high.

A useful bid leveling system should help you see:

  • Which drawings, specs, addenda, and bid forms each sub priced
  • Which inclusions and exclusions differ by proposal
  • Which alternates are included, excluded, or unclear
  • Which allowances, unit prices, taxes, delivery, freight, and mobilization assumptions differ
  • Which trade scopes overlap or leave gaps
  • Which follow-up questions need to be sent before award
  • Which scope decision must carry into the subcontract and project handoff

If the software only stores PDF proposals and shows totals, it is more of a file cabinet than a leveling workflow.

Features to Compare

Use a feature checklist, but tie each feature to a field or contract problem.

FeatureWhy it mattersWhat to test
Proposal extractionSaves retyping and reduces missed linesDoes it catch exclusions, alternates, unit prices, and notes?
Scope matrixMakes bid comparison visibleCan you customize by trade and project type?
Plan roomKeeps drawings and addenda organizedCan subs access the right files and can you track what changed?
Bid invitationsReduces email chaosCan you track responses, declined bids, and late bids?
Buyout logCarries award decisions forwardDoes it track awarded scope, savings, and open items?
HandoffPrevents PMs from inheriting scattered assumptionsCan field teams see exclusions, alternates, and clarifications?
TemplatesStandardizes estimator habitsCan you create trade-specific scopes and checklists?

Do not give equal weight to every feature. A small GC with three estimators may need scope clarity more than a complex analytics dashboard. A larger GC may need permissions, audit trails, standardized templates, and portfolio-level buyout logs.

Questions to Ask in the Demo

Do not let the demo stay at the polished sample-project level. Bring a real subcontractor proposal with exclusions, alternates, handwritten notes, and scope gaps.

Ask:

  1. Can the tool ingest messy subcontractor proposals without losing notes?
  2. Can it separate base bid, alternates, allowances, unit prices, tax, freight, and exclusions?
  3. Can we define our own scope checklist by trade?
  4. Can we compare proposals side by side without flattening important qualifications?
  5. Can a PM see the final leveling decisions after award?
  6. Can we export the buyout log or scope sheet if we leave the platform?
  7. What happens when an addendum changes scope after proposals are in?
  8. Can we restrict access by project, trade, or role?
  9. How are files, proposal data, notes, and subcontractor information stored?
  10. What does implementation look like for the first 30 days?

The answer you want is not always "yes." Sometimes the more revealing answer is how the vendor handles an edge case.

Where It Can Fail

Bid leveling software can fail when the company treats it as a substitute for preconstruction judgment.

Common failure points:

  • Estimators skip scope review because the matrix looks complete.
  • The tool extracts proposal totals but misses exclusion language.
  • Templates are too generic for real trade differences.
  • PMs do not use the award notes after handoff.
  • Subs keep sending proposals in formats the system does not handle well.
  • Addenda and revised proposals are not versioned carefully.
  • The company buys the tool but does not change its bid-day process.

Software can reduce friction. It cannot make an incomplete project scope complete.

Pricing and Break-Even

Use the same discipline you use when pricing a job. The SBA break-even framing is useful: a software subscription becomes a fixed operating cost that must be recovered through better throughput, fewer missed gaps, cleaner buyout, or reduced admin time.

Before signing, estimate:

  • Monthly subscription cost
  • Implementation time
  • Template setup time
  • Training time for estimators and PMs
  • Number of projects that will actually use the tool
  • Expected reduction in retyping, missed exclusions, and handoff cleanup
  • Cost of keeping the old process alive during transition

Avoid justifying the tool with vague "time saved" language. Name the exact work it should reduce: proposal entry, scope comparison, follow-up emails, buyout log updates, PM handoff meetings, or post-award cleanup.

Data Ownership and Exit Risk

The bid leveling system may store subcontractor proposals, pricing, alternates, scope notes, buyout logs, and award decisions. That is sensitive operating data.

Ask:

  • Can we export project data?
  • What format does export use?
  • What happens to data after cancellation?
  • Who owns uploaded subcontractor proposals?
  • Are subcontractor contacts and pricing used for any shared network?
  • How is access revoked when an employee leaves?
  • Does the vendor support backups or audit logs?

The bigger the GC, the more these questions matter. The smaller the GC, the easier it is to ignore them until the company is locked into a workflow it cannot leave cleanly.

Implementation Checklist

Run one controlled pilot before rolling the system across the company.

Use a project with enough complexity to test the workflow, but not a project where the team cannot tolerate process friction.

Pilot checklist:

  1. Pick one estimator, one PM, and one project.
  2. Define the trade scopes that will be leveled.
  3. Build scope templates before proposals come in.
  4. Load drawings, specs, and addenda.
  5. Send or upload real subcontractor proposals.
  6. Track every extraction miss, template gap, and handoff issue.
  7. Compare the final buyout log against the old spreadsheet.
  8. Review whether the PM can build from the awarded scope notes.
  9. Decide what must change before broader rollout.

If the pilot only proves that the software can host files, it did not test enough.

Who Should Wait

Do not buy bid leveling software yet if:

  • You do not have a repeatable scope review process.
  • You rarely compare more than two subcontractor proposals.
  • Your team will not maintain templates.
  • You cannot name who owns implementation.
  • Your current problem is poor estimating judgment, not workflow friction.
  • You need legal, contract, or procurement advice more than software.

In those cases, fix the checklist first. Software can formalize a good process. It can also formalize a sloppy one.

Final Buying Review

Before buying, confirm:

  1. The tool improves scope comparison, not only file storage.
  2. It handles exclusions, alternates, addenda, and revisions.
  3. It produces a useful buyout log or award record.
  4. It supports PM handoff.
  5. Pricing makes sense against expected usage.
  6. Data export and cancellation terms are clear.
  7. The implementation owner is named.
  8. The pilot project has clear pass/fail criteria.

Bid leveling software is worth considering when it makes the GC's judgment easier to apply. It is not worth much when it only makes incomplete comparisons look more organized.
